What International Paper does
International Paper is a global packaging company that produces renewable fiber-based packaging products across North America, Latin America, Europe and North Africa. The company has undergone significant transformation to simplify operations and strengthen performance, including the acquisition of DS Smith and the recent divestiture of its Global Cellulose Fibers business. It is executing a strategic separation to create two independent, publicly traded companies in North America and EMEA, with completion targeted for late 2026 or early 2027.
